IN THE UNITED STATES DISTRICT COURT
FOR THE DISTRICT OF COLORADO
Judge Philip A. Brimmer
Civil Action No. 09-cv-00088-PAB-CBS
In re: CENTRIX FINANCIAL, LLC, et al.,
Debtors,
CENTRIX FINANCIAL LIQUIDATING TRUST, et al.,
Plaintiffs,
v.
ROBERT E. SUTTON, et al.,
Defendants.
_____________________________________________________________________
ORDER OF DISMISSAL WITH PREJUDICE AS TO
DEFENDANTS HARRISON BUILDERS, LTD. AND GRAND CONSTRUCTION, LLC
_____________________________________________________________________
This matter comes before the Court on Plaintiffs’ Motion to Dismiss Action
Against Defendants Harrison Builders, Ltd. and Grand Construction, LLC [Docket No.
137]. The Court has reviewed the pleading and is fully advised in the premises. It is
ORDERED that Plaintiffs’ Motion to Dismiss Action Against Defendants Harrison
Builders, Ltd. and Grand Construction, LLC [Docket No. 137] is GRANTED. It is further
ORDERED that, pursuant to Fed. R. Civ. P. 41(a), all claims asserted against
defendants Harrison Builders, Ltd. and Grand Construction, LLC are dismissed with
prejudice, with each party to bear its own attorneys’ fees and costs.
DATED April 4, 2014.
BY THE COURT:
s/Philip A. Brimmer
PHILIP A. BRIMMER
United States District Judge
